A survey of available literature shows the result of a tremendous Soviet effort in the field of palynology. Russian work in this field was initiated in the early 1930s and began to be summarized in publications at about the time of the 1937 International Geological Congress in Moscow. The work has been extended and expanded many times since then. During the last ten years, palynological publications in Russian have appeared en masse. An analysis of available practices in palynology and policies regarding nomenclature and taxonomy in the literature are presented, even though conclusions must be regarded as tentative and personal. Any American viewpoint about the present development of palynology in the U.S.S.R. must be both incomplete and inadequate. However, the literatur reflects tremendous effort and a large source of information applicable to general paleontologic, paleogeographic, and paleoecologic problems.
